## Runbook: GraphScope render failures

If GraphScope shows a blank canvas or "cycle budget exceeded," the dependency graph is too deep for the default traversal cap. Do not restart the worker first — restarting drops the layout cache and makes it worse. Check the queue depth on the Fennick dashboard; anything over 200 means the pruner is stuck. Kill the pruner process, then confirm the service picked up the settings below before re-queuing jobs.

deployment values, yadup-kadug:
[sorys]
port = 5672
team = noveth
host = sorys.orvexcorp.example
region = south-4
access_code = ac_deddc1
timeout_ms = 1500

## Formula sandbox tuning

User-supplied formulas in Gridmoor execute inside a restricted interpreter with hard ceilings on time, memory, and call depth. Reviewers should confirm any change to these ceilings is justified in the PR description, since raising them widens the abuse surface. Defaults were chosen from production traces. The current limits are as follows.

limits module of tafog-fawip:
WEIGHTS = {
    "julix": 57,
    "lamys": 992,
    "kasvan": 209,
    "quenok": 750,
    "alddor": 259,
    "oliath": 1009,
    "wenix": 815,
}

For the sync: the Pinefold scanner integration now debounces duplicate reads and validates checksums before enqueueing. I kept the retry path conservative because the handheld units occasionally emit partial frames under low battery. Please review the debounce window carefully — it interacts with the conveyor speed at the Harlow depot. The values currently in the branch are these:

limits module of yadug-tawip:
QUOTAS = {
    "julael": 705,
    "kasael": 903,
    "druwyn": 489,
}